Web-Based Drills in Maths Using a Computer Algebra System

Multimedia elements addressing mathematical problems serve as an alternative or addition to classical forms of learning and teaching. Within the project math-kit we are developing a web-based toolbox to provide teachers and students with multimedia support to existing topics in maths. In this context, the integration of a computer algebra system (CAS) as a 'mathematical expert' offers many promising opportunities for the creation of internet-based learning units for undergraduate students. In this paper we show two examples of how the CAS MuPAD is used to create webbased mathematical drills with instant feedback.
